Description
Making gluten-free pizza that’s just as satisfying as traditional pizza can seem challenging – but with the right techniques, it’s absolutely achievable! This course is designed to simplify gluten-free pizza making, ensuring you create a pizza that’s crispy, flavourful, and structurally sound.
You’ll explore the science behind gluten-free baking, learn how to craft a dough that’s easy to handle, and master baking techniques for a perfectly cooked pizza. Plus, you’ll dive into exciting topping ideas that cater to different dietary preferences, from classic flavours to gourmet combinations.
By the end of this course, you'll be fully equipped to make gluten-free pizzas that are not only easy but also incredibly delicious.
Course Curriculum
Module 01: Understanding Gluten-Free Pizza Basics
- What is Gluten?
- The Science behind Gluten-Free Baking
- Types of Gluten-Free Flours
- Gluten-Free Pizza vs Traditional Pizza
- Common Pitfalls in Gluten-Free Baking
- Setting Up Your Gluten-Free Kitchen
Module 02: Crafting the Perfect Gluten-Free Pizza Dough
- Selecting the Right Flour Blend
- Binding Agents and Additives
- Making the Dough Step-by-Step
- Resting and Rising
- Troubleshooting Dough Issues
- Storing Gluten-Free Dough
Module 03: Baking Gluten-Free Pizza to Perfection
- Right Oven and Temperature
- Using Pizza Stones and Trays
- Timing is Everything
- Pre-Baking for Crispy Crusts
- Meal-Prep Ideas: Gluten-Free Pizzas in Advance
- Experimenting with Different Crust Thicknesses
Module 04: Topping Ideas and Creative Gluten-Free Pizzas
- Traditional Toppings with a Twist
- Vegan and Dairy-Free Options
- Customising Your Sauce
- Layering and Balancing Flavours
- Pizza Styles to Try
